California Among 39 States Testing Horses for CEM


California is among 39 states testing horses that might have been exposed to a highly contagious venereal disease of horses, contagious equine metritis (CEM). California Department of Food and Agriculture veterinarians have quarantined 14 mares and are working with the USDA and regulatory veterinarians in other states to identify any additional exposed horses as this nationwide ...
